Job Description:

We are seeking to appoint a dynamic and ambitious Nursery Manager at Heathcote House Nursery in the beautiful market town of Devizes. The successful candidate will be passionate about delivering high-quality Early Years provision and experienced in managing a setting with 90-100+ children attending. You will be responsible for leading the day-to-day operation of the nursery with the support of Wishford Education, and be ready to take an already successful nursery to new heights.

Job Responsibility:

  • Manage the day-to-day operation of the nursery, ensuring compliance with EYFS, and health and safety standards
  • Lead the next stage of nursery growth, including marketing and implementation
  • Have an up to date working knowledge of the Early Years Framework and all other statutory guidance
  • Inspire a large and friendly team of early years professionals and provide regular training and continued staff support
  • Monitor and maintain high standards of care, education, and safeguarding
  • Work closely with the Nursery Area Manager and the support team from Wishford Education to manage child occupancy, financial budgets, and staffing
  • Work with Talent Acquisition Partner to recruit and induct new staff members
  • Act as the Designated Safeguarding Lead (DSL) for the nursery, ensuring all staff understand and comply with safeguarding procedures
  • Lead on all safeguarding matters, including referrals, staff training, and liaising with external agencies, and ensuring full compliance with EYFS, Ofsted, and local authority regulations
  • Maintain accurate, confidential records for children, staff, and incidents
  • Keep safeguarding logs, accident/incident reports, and child development records up to date
  • Maintain up-to-date knowledge of safeguarding legislation and best practices
  • Take overall responsibility for the safety and the well-being of all children in the setting, conducting regular risk assessments, and promoting a culture of vigilance and proactive safeguarding among all staff
  • Maximise nursery occupancy through proactive enrolment strategies and excellent parent engagement
  • Ensure efficient staff deployment aligned with child ratios and budget constraints
  • Oversee procurement and use of resources to ensure quality and cost-efficiency
  • Lead local marketing initiatives and promote the nursery through events and community outreach
  • Work with the Nursery Marketing and Admissions Executive to manage the nursery’s online presence
  • Monitor and respond to parent feedback and online reviews, mainly on DayNurseries.com, to maintain a positive reputation
  • Build strong relationships with the local community to enhance visibility and trust
  • Work with the Nursery Finance Business Partner to achieve financial targets, manage nursery budgets, and monitor income and expenditure
  • Oversee fee collection processes and manage outstanding charges professionally and sensitively
  • Motivate and inspire your nursery team
  • Foster a positive, collaborative team culture that encourages high morale and staff engagement
  • Conduct regular performance reviews, support senior/room leaders, and set clear goals, targets and expectations
  • Promote a healthy work-life balance and implement wellbeing initiatives
  • Identify training needs, support continuous professional development, and ensure all staff meet required qualifications and standards
  • Create a safe, stimulating, and nurturing environment where children flourish
  • Lead the delivery of the EYFS curriculum with creativity and care
  • Oversee planning, assessment, and evaluation to ensure high-quality learning experiences
  • Support children with additional needs in collaboration with the Nursery Area Manager and external agencies
  • Build strong, positive relationships with parents through regular communication, meetings, and events
  • Ensure new families feel welcomed and supported from their first visit
  • Represent the nursery with professionalism, warmth, and integrity at all times
  • Foster strong relationships with families, ensuring open communication and trust

Requirements:

  • Level 3, 4, or 5 qualification in Early Years (e.g., CACHE, NVQ)
  • Minimum 3 years’ experience in nursery management, ideally in a large setting (90+ occupancy)
  • Proven track record of delivering high standards in early years education and care
  • In-depth understanding of the EYFS framework and early childhood development
  • Strong leadership and team management skills
  • Excellent communication, organisation, and time management
  • Confident in using data to drive improvement and inform planning
  • IT literate, with experience using nursery management systems (e.g., EYWorks)
  • Be financially aware and target-drive, with proven experience in managing budgets, controlling costs and achieving financial objectives
